Currently living in Bangkok in Thailand and notice the growth with construction, new rail systems and upgraded living conditions. There is an emerging middle class in Thailand that demand concrete & steel, cars, bikes and everyday items like the kitchen sink. If this is the same in other parts of asia like china, Malaysia, Vietnam, laos, Cambodia, Burma and india then we should only take the export figures lightly and focus on the internal consumption of the region. Also take into account that both Indonesia and india have decided to stop raw iron ore exports by 2014 for the reason of internal demand and resource security for the future.
